Simple, Yet Customizable

Another reason why ice pops are such a hit is their simplicity. They don’t require fancy equipment or a lot of ingredients. In fact, you can make your own at home with just some fruit juice and molds. However, ice pops can also be easily customized to fit your preferences. You can make creamy versions with yogurt, go for natural fruit juice to keep it healthy, or even add a touch of sparkle with carbonated water.

Fun Fact: Accidental Invention

Did you know the ice pop was invented by accident? In 1905, an 11-year-old boy named Frank Epperson left a mixture of water and flavored powder on his porch with a stick in it. The chilly night froze the mixture solid, creating the first ice pop. Over 100 years later, ice pops are still one of the most loved summer snacks around!
